Quick question, with Collison missing the year with his shoulder, is he still eligible for ROY next year, even though he'll be in the second year of his rookie contract. other players have been drafted and then been classified as rookies later on because they play overseas (ie - Stojakovic, Sabonis etc), but is Collison eligible if he doesn't play a game? Any help on this would be appreciated
Yes he's eligible. Speedy Claxton didn't play his first season and was eligible to win the award the season after he was hurt.
Think the same went for big Z as well, matter of fact he played in the rookie game the next year after he missed the first year due to injury. He was the MVP of that game too.
